ABSTRACT Aquaponic is a farming system that use water continuously from fish rearing to the plant and conversely. Aquaponic system aims to reduce the level of ammonia produced by fish feces and feed waste then maintain oxygen level in recycling water through an existing system. Determination of the optimal stocking density in aquaponic will ensure the best survival and growth of fish. The research was conducted since March to April 2016 at the Laboratory of Aquaculture, Aquaculture Study Program, Faculty of Agriculture, Sriwijaya University, Indralaya. This research used a completely randomized design (CRD) with four treatments with three replications of stocking density 100, 150, 200, dan 250 fish/m2. Based on observations during the study, the highest percentage for survival rate was 84.67% (P2=150 fish), whereas growth for the highest percentage of both absolute weight and lenght were 1.42 g and 1.52 cm (P1=100 fish), however there were no significan differences between P1 dan P2. Plant growth data show that the best growth was in P3 (200 fish). Based on research results, P2 (150 fish) wassugested to apply for the tilapia in aquaponic system.   Key words : Aquaponic,Tilapia, Stocking density

ABSTRACT This current research aimed to find out survival and growth of snakehead fish (Channa striata) reared in different pH media modification and to find out the optimum pH for rearing. Research was conducted in Aquaculture Laboratory, Aquaculture Program Study, Agriculture Faculty, Sriwijaya University from October toNovember2012. This researchcurrent used completely randomized design with  five treatments and three replications. The treatments were P0 (without treatments), P1 (decreased from pH 5.75 to 3.00), P2 (decreased from pH 5.75 to 4.00), P3 (decreased from pH 5.75 to 5.00) and  P4 (increased from pH 5.75 to 6.00).   The result of this  current research showed that the best  survival rate and growth based on regression analysis growth and weight total biomass end was found for P3 treatment (decreased from pH 5.75 to 5.00). Result of water physical and chemical measered were dissolved oxigen 4.32-4.77 mg.L-1, temperature 26-280C, and amonia 0.0030-0.1281 mg.L-1. Keywords : Channa striata, Ikan gabus, pH

ABSTRACT The purpose of this research were to determine the best ratio of injection pituitary extract of climbing perch, latency time, amount of egg,  percentage fertilized of egg, percentage hatching of egg and survival rate of climbing perch pro larvae. The research was conducted at Laboratorium Dasar Perikanan, Department of Aquaculture, Agriculture Faculty, Sriwijaya University since September until November 2014. The research used completely randomized design with 4 treatments and 3 replications. Those were P1 (1 donors : 1 recipient), P2 (2 donors: 1 recipient), P3 (3 donors : 1 recipient) and K(+) (®ovaprim 0.5 ml/kg). Based on to the honest significant different test showed that climbing perch pituitary extract injection of different ratio of weight fish had significantly different to latency time, amount of egg rate, percentage fertilized of egg but it’s not significantly different to percentage hatching of egg and survival rate. The best spawning latency time was P3 (9 hours 25 minutes), amount of egg was K(+) (10,123 grain), the highest percentage fertilized of eggs was P3 (98.25 %), the highest hatching percentage of eggs was P2 (93.90 %) and the highest survival rate pro larvae of climbing perch was P1 (87.71 %). Keywords: climbing perch, spawning, different weight ratio, donor, recipient

ABSTRACT Snakehead fish is one of swamp fish species that has not been successfully cultivated intensively, therefore it is necessary to do a particular effort for rearing snakehead fish. Rearing of fry snakehead fish in the swamp water media by modifiying pH is expected to be able to support the survival rate and growth.The research uses CDR with 5 treatments and 3 replications. Modification of water pH will be done by adding HCl or NaOH. Increasing or decreasing pH will be conducted continuosly for 30 days. The result of this research showed that continues modification of rearing media pH is very significantly affected survival rate of fry snakehead fish with P3 (decreasing from pH 5.75 to pH 5.00) as the best treatment. This treatment gave survival rate of 67.90% and weight biomass of 9.8982 grams Keywords : Fry snakehead fish, pH, swamp water, survival rate and growth

ABSTRACT The use of natural honey in the process of Betta fish masculinization are expected to reduce the concentration of estrogen hormone and increase the testosterone. The purpose of this research is to determine the effect of natural honey to the percentage of the male betta fish by masculinization. This study has been conducted at the Aquaculture Laboratory, Faculty of Agriculture, Sriwijaya University. This study use a completely randomized design with 4 treatments and 3 replications. The treatment in this research was betta fish larvae aged 5 days that submersed on natural honey media with different concentration for 12 hours. The treatment were the addition of natural honey as much as 4 ml/L (P1), 5 ml/L (P2), 6 ml/L (P3), 7 ml/L (P4) and without natural honey addition as control (P0). Parameters observed consist of percentage of betta fish male, survival rate and quality of water. The result of this research shows that the addition of natural honey with difference concentration has significant effect to male betta fish percentage. Treatment P2 with concentration 5 ml/L is the best result, it produced 77.33% of male betta fish after immersion for 12 hours. Keywords : Betta fish (Betta sp.), Masculinization, Natural honey

The purpose of this study was to determine the effect of giving bull pituitary extract on the development of gonads of female broodstock of climbing perch (Anabas testudineus). The research method used a completely randomized design, four treatment doses of pituitary extract, namely 0.0; 0.1; 0.3; 0.6 ml/kg. Muscular injection of pituitary extract. The results showed that the dose of 0.6 ml/kg, the best performance of gonad development, where the egg diameter was 0.640 mm, the somatic index was 4.22%, the hepatosomatic index was 0.18% and the total fecundity was 6404 eggs. Water quality parameters during fish rearing are in a good range for gonad development of climbing perch fish.

Cimbing perch fish is one of the prospective species to be developed into anaquaculture commodity.The purposes of this study was to determine the performance of the results of spawning of climbing perch fish in tarpaulin with different water levels. The study was conducted at the Aquaculture Laboratory, Aquaculture Study Program, Faculty of Agriculture, Sriwijaya University, Indralaya. The study design used a completely randomized design, three treatments, three replications. The treatment is different water levels: P1 (16 cm), P2 (28 cm), P3 (40 cm). The results showed that different water levels had a significant effect on latent time, number of eggs and survival of larvae (D0 - D3) of climbing perch fish.The study showed that the treatment of P3 (40 cm) gave the fastest latency time, which was 16,077 minutes, 4,347 eggs spawned and the percentage of survival of larvae (D0-D3) 88.82%. Conclusion, the best water level for spawning climbing perch in a tarpaulin pond is 40 cm.

The Fish Under Crew Cultivator Group is located in Pulau Semambu Village which was established in 2016 with fish commodities, including fish ponds. The aquacultured fish can already respond to the artificial feed given. However, the use of feed by the aquaculture fish is still not efficient. This is a problem faced by fish farmers, including in the Fish Under Crew group. The addition of papain enzymes in feed can increase feed digestibility so that fish can utilize feed more efficiently. The purpose of this community service activity is to apply the use of the papain enzyme in artificial feed to increase feed digestibility and its effect on the growth and production of aquaculture fish. Methods of activity include: 1) socialization of activities, 2) counseling to group members and the community in Pulau Semambu Village, 3) providing assistance in the form of two tarpaulin ponds with iron frames and their accessories, 4) Application of board enzymes to fish through fish rearing activities for 1 year. months, using two treatments, namely 0% papain enzyme in feed as control (P0) and 0.75% papain enzyme in feed (P1). Socialization and counseling were carried out by involving group members and the community in Pulau Semambu Village. The community understands the extension material presented and is very enthusiastic to apply it in their cultivation activities as evidenced by very interactive question and answer sessions during the discussion session and answers to the questionnaires given to participants. The pool assistance was received by group members, accompanied by village officials and Bumdesma administrators. In fish rearing by applying the addition of papain enzyme to feed, it gave a higher absolute growth rate (absolute weight growth 0.41 g and absolute length 0.56 cm) than commercial feed without the addition of papain enzyme. Based on the activities that have been carried out, UPR Fish Under Crew has applied the addition of papain enzymes to feed for aquaculture fish. The results obtained can increase the growth of the pond fish that are kept and the use of feed is more efficient.

Kualitas air tambak yang menurun seringkali disebabkan kurangnya pengelolaan tanah dasar yang berakibat kurang optimalnya produksi budidaya ikan. Tujuan dari penelitian ini adalah untuk mengetahui karakteristik fisika dan kimia sedimen tambak tradisional ikan bandeng di Banyuasin II, Kabupaten Banyuasin, Sumatera Selatan. Hasil dari penelitian menunjukkan bahwa tekstur tanah pada masing masing tambak yang disampling tergolong lempung berpasir. Bahan organik tanah pada setiap tambak cukup tinggi dengan nilai berkisar antara 7,08-14,15%. pH tanah tergolong asam-sangat asam dengan nilai 3,38-4,63. Hasil uji kadar besi menunjukkan nilai yang sangat tinggi pada setiap tambak, berkisar antara 2,28-42,12 mg kg-1. Kandungan kalsium dan magnesium cukup rendah, yaitu      4,81-9,91 Cmol kg-1 dan 0,96-3,09 Cmol kg-1. Hasil analisis akumulasi sedimen menunjukkan nilai mulai dari 12,14 cm per tahun hingga 22,86 cm per tahun. Meskipun karakteristik tambak belum menunjukkan masalah yang berat untuk pemeliharaan ikan bandeng, namun produktivitas tambak menjadi kurang optimal. Tanpa pengelolaan tanah dasar yang baik pada tambak, diperkirakan kualitas tambak akan terus menurun untuk pemeliharaan ikan yang akan datang

Banana shrimp is one of the potential export shrimp cultivated in Brondong, Lamongan. Antibiotic residues, including pollutants, can come from cultivation pond areas and environmental pollution. The antibiotics in shrimp are tetracycline groups (oxytetracycline, chlortetracycline, and tetracycline) and chloramphenicol.  This study aims to determine the presence of antibiotic residues in banana shrimp and whether the quality of the shrimp has met health safety standards based on antibiotic residue analysis using estimated daily intake (EDI) and hazard quotient (HQ) calculations. Examination of antibiotic residues is carried out at the UPT. Quality Testing and Development of Marine and Fisheries Products in Surabaya. This study used an observation method by taking shrimp samples, measuring pond water quality parameters, and testing the content of antibiotic residues in the laboratory. The examination results showed that residues of the tetracycline and chloramphenicol groups were not detected in banana shrimp. Calculations of EDI and HQ cannot be performed because antibiotic residues are not detected. The HQ value is below one, which indicates a low-risk level category. Banana shrimp from a farming pond in Brondong, Lamongan is safe for human consumption.
